What is the airport code for Chengdu China?
Chengdu Shuangliu International Airport
Chengdu Shuangliu International Airport (IATA: CTU) is the primary international airport serving Chengdu, the capital city of Sichuan province in China. It is located approximately 16 kilometers (10 miles) southwest of downtown Chengdu.
